Viet Nam’s retail market expected to sustain steady growth

Viet Nam’s retail market was estimated to reach a scale of around 269 billion USD in 2025, with total retail sales of goods and consumer service revenue rising by 9–10% year on year, the fastest growth rate recorded in the past five years, excluding the period of disruption caused by the pandemic.

Towards sustainable development of retail trade sector

According to the Overview Report on Viet Nam's Domestic Market 2025 recently released by the Agency for Domestic Market Surveillance and Development under the Ministry of Industry and Trade, the scale of Viet Nam’s retail market for goods and services in 2025 reached more than 7 quadrillion VND, up around 10% compared with 2024.

Sustainable development of e-commerce market

According to data from the Agency for Domestic Market Surveillance and Development under the Ministry of Industry and Trade, e-commerce is playing a pivotal role in promoting the development of Viet Nam’s retail market. It not only contributes to revenue growth but also expands market access and promotes digital consumption.
